نتایج جستجو برای: bpel
تعداد نتایج: 928 فیلتر نتایج به سال:
Formalized analysis method is a technology that insures quality of software reliability. It can detect mistakes and flaws effectively in software design. Based on the research of model checking techniques for composition of web services, we establish an automatic test framework for web services composition of BPEL. Static test method is used and test cases are generated automatically in this fr...
We describe the StAC language which can be used to specify the orchestration of activities in long running business transactions. Long running business transactions use compensation to cope with exceptions. StAC supports sequential and parallel behaviour as well as exception and compensation handling. We also show how the B notation may be combined with StAC to specify the data aspects of trans...
Grid computing aims to create an accessible virtual supercomputer by integrating distributed computers to form a parallel infrastructure for processing applications. To enable service-oriented Grid computing, the Grid computing architecture was aligned with the current Web service technologies; thereby, making it possible for Grid applications to be exposed as Web services. The WSRF set of spec...
With the advent of XML-based SOA, WS-BPEL shortly turned out to become a widely accepted standard for modeling business processes. Though SOA is said to embrace the principle of business agility, BPEL process definitions are still manually crafted into their final executable version. While SOA has proven to be a giant leap forward in building flexible IT systems, this static BPEL workflow model...
Correct synchronization among activities is critical in a business process. Current process languages such as BPEL specify the control flow of processes procedurally, which can lead to inflexible and tangled code for managing a crosscutting aspect—synchronization constraints that define permissible sequences of execution for activities. In this article, we present DSCWeaver, a tool that enables...
Controlling access to the Web services of public agencies and private corporations depends primarily on specifying and deploying functional security rules to satisfy strict regulations imposed by governments, particularly in the financial and health sectors. This paper focuses on one aspect of the SELKIS and EB3SEC projects related to the security of Web-based information systems, namely, the a...
The derivation of business process execution language (BPEL) for web services from graph-oriented process models has attained wide focus in the literature. It is a challenging work owing to the fundamental differences between graph-oriented models and BPEL. In this paper, a transformation of activity diagrams (AD) into BPEL is presented, which concentrates on a specific kind of structure in gra...
Management of the coordination between the control flow of the composition and the navigation flow of its user interface BPEL standard expresses a composition in a fully automated way How can users interact with the Web services during the composition execution? Motivation Design of an interactive Web service composition Generation of an adapted User Interface for the composition as well as an ...
BPEL (Business Process Execution Language) is proposed as a standard language to describe Web service fl ows. A fl ow may contain multiple activities that are executed concurrently, and thus removing faults such as deadlocks or violations of application-specifi c properties is not easy. This paper proposes techniques to extract a behavioral specifi cation from the BPEL program and to verity it ...
Modeling complex process control flows is made possible by the definition of the Web Services Business Process Execution Language (BPEL). This language, however, does not support the modeling of processes which involve human user interactions. For answering this need, an extension of BPEL has been developed, i.e. BPEL4People. The report presents the background and motivation for the development...
نمودار تعداد نتایج جستجو در هر سال
با کلیک روی نمودار نتایج را به سال انتشار فیلتر کنید